City Council Approves Verizon Wireless CUP Renewal Through 2035
The Cerritos Planning Commission made a significant decision during its meeting on September 3, 2025, by approving a new ten-year period for a Conditional Use Permit (CUP) for Verizon Wireless. This approval allows Verizon to continue its operations in the city until 2035, addressing the ongoing need for reliable telecommunications services in the community.

During the meeting, a representative from Base Consulting, which represents Verizon, explained the renewal process for the CUP. The representative highlighted that there are often changes in ownership and management of such permits, but Verizon is committed to maintaining its services and ensuring a smooth transition during these changes. This renewal is crucial as it supports the infrastructure necessary for residents to stay connected, especially in an era where digital communication is vital for both personal and professional interactions.

The commission's vote was unanimous, passing with a 5-0 tally, reflecting strong support for the continued presence of Verizon in Cerritos.
